Transaction 21e3a98c5ac412a089163c37005fd3b7efe5142e59ba22b3bb93ab98343266a0
1 Input
1 Output
-
21e3a98c5ac412a089163c37005fd3b7efe5142e59ba22b3bb93ab98343266a0:0
- value
- 914525
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fcb6aba8a2d6679f96ec4d4a2ac94d677cdba4b
- address
- bc1q3l9k4w5294n8n7twcn229ty56emumwjtayaq5u